Amazon's Multi-faceted CRM: A Holistic Approach

Amazon doesn't rely on a single, off-the-shelf CRM solution. Instead, it employs a complex, integrated system built from various internal tools, acquired technologies, and custom-developed software. This approach reflects Amazon's commitment to tailoring its CRM to its unique needs and massive scale. Key components likely include:

  • Data Warehousing and Analytics: Amazon collects an unparalleled amount of customer data, ranging from purchase history and browsing behavior to product reviews and customer service interactions. This data is stored in massive data warehouses and analyzed using advanced machine learning algorithms. This data forms the bedrock of Amazon's personalization engine.

  • Personalized Recommendation Engines: This is arguably the most visible aspect of Amazon's CRM. Sophisticated algorithms analyze customer data to predict future purchases and offer personalized product recommendations. These recommendations are not only displayed on product pages but also integrated throughout the entire user experience.

  • Customer Service and Support Systems: Amazon's customer service is renowned for its efficiency and responsiveness. This is supported by a sophisticated system that manages customer inquiries across various channels (email, phone, chat), tracks resolution times, and provides agents with access to relevant customer data.

  • Marketing Automation and Targeting: Amazon utilizes extensive marketing automation tools to personalize marketing communications. This ensures that customers receive relevant offers and promotions based on their browsing history and purchase behavior. This personalized approach significantly increases the effectiveness of its marketing efforts.

  • Supply Chain and Logistics Integration: Amazon's CRM is tightly integrated with its vast logistics network. Real-time data on inventory levels, shipping times, and delivery status is crucial for meeting customer expectations and maintaining operational efficiency. This seamless integration ensures a smooth and transparent customer experience.

  • Third-Party Seller Management: Amazon's marketplace relies on a massive network of third-party sellers. Managing these sellers, ensuring product quality, and resolving disputes requires robust CRM tools to handle communications, performance metrics, and conflict resolution.

Connecting Amazon's Logistics Network with its CRM

Amazon's logistics network plays a critical role in its overall CRM strategy. The speed and efficiency of its delivery services directly impact customer satisfaction. The real-time tracking information, proactive delivery updates, and various delivery options are all integrated aspects of its CRM. Amazon’s ability to predict demand based on CRM data allows for optimized inventory management and minimizes delivery delays, further strengthening customer relationships. This integrated approach ensures a smooth and efficient process, enhancing the overall customer journey. Delays or inefficiencies in the logistics network would negatively impact customer perception and directly contradict the personalization delivered by the CRM itself.

Risks and Mitigations in Amazon's CRM Approach

While Amazon's CRM approach is highly effective, it also presents risks:

  • Data Privacy Concerns: The collection and use of vast amounts of customer data raise privacy concerns. Amazon must navigate complex regulations and maintain transparency to build and retain customer trust.

  • System Complexity and Maintenance: Managing such a complex system requires significant investment in infrastructure and expertise. Maintaining system stability and security is paramount.

  • Over-reliance on Algorithms: While algorithms are powerful, they can lead to unintended biases or inaccurate predictions. Human oversight and continuous improvement are essential.

  • Dependence on Data Accuracy: The effectiveness of Amazon's CRM relies on the accuracy and completeness of its data. Maintaining data integrity is a crucial aspect of the system's success.

Exploring the Connection Between Data Analytics and Amazon's CRM

Data analytics forms the heart of Amazon's CRM. The sheer volume of data collected allows for granular insights into customer behavior, preferences, and needs. This data is used to:

  • Personalize Recommendations: Algorithms analyze purchase history, browsing behavior, and other data points to predict future purchases.

  • Target Marketing Campaigns: Amazon uses data to segment customers and tailor marketing messages for maximum effectiveness.

  • Optimize Operations: Data insights guide inventory management, logistics planning, and customer service strategies.

  • Identify Trends and Opportunities: Analysis of customer data can reveal emerging trends, allowing Amazon to proactively adapt its offerings and strategies.

Data Analytics' Role in Amazon's CRM (Illustrative Example)

Aspect Impact on Amazon's CRM Example
Purchase History Informs personalized product recommendations and targeted marketing campaigns. Recommending similar products after a purchase, or offering discounts on related items.
Browsing Behavior Used to understand customer interests and tailor product displays and recommendations. Showing products related to items viewed but not purchased.
Customer Reviews Provides feedback on products and services, informing product improvements and customer service. Addressing negative reviews and improving product descriptions based on feedback.
Customer Service Data Analyzes customer interactions to identify pain points and improve customer service processes. Identifying frequently asked questions and proactively providing solutions.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

  • Q: What CRM software does Amazon use? A: Amazon doesn't rely on a single, off-the-shelf CRM. It uses a custom-built system combining various internal tools and acquired technologies.

  • Q: How does Amazon collect so much customer data? A: Amazon collects data through various channels, including purchase history, browsing activity, customer reviews, and customer service interactions.

  • Q: Is Amazon's data collection ethical? A: Amazon's data practices are subject to ongoing debate. While it provides significant benefits to customers through personalization, concerns remain regarding data privacy and transparency. It is crucial to adhere to data protection regulations and build customer trust through transparency.

  • Q: Can smaller businesses replicate Amazon's CRM strategy? A: While replicating Amazon's exact system is impractical for smaller businesses, they can adapt key principles like personalized communication, data-driven decision-making, and seamless omnichannel integration.

  • Q: How does Amazon maintain the accuracy of its vast data sets? A: Amazon invests heavily in data management and quality control processes, implementing mechanisms to ensure data integrity and accuracy. This is a continuous and evolving process.

  • Q: What are the ethical implications of Amazon's data usage? A: Amazon’s massive data collection and utilization raise significant ethical concerns regarding user privacy and potential misuse. Striking a balance between personalized services and user rights is paramount.
